Value of Child Teeth Treatment



You need to prioritize cleaning and flossing to preserve the total wellness of your kid's primary teeth. Baby teeth play an important duty in your youngster's dental development. They aid your kid eat, talk, and smile appropriately.



Ignoring the care of baby teeth can bring about numerous dental wellness issues, such as tooth decay and periodontal disease. Flossing once daily is just as vital to cleanse the locations in between the teeth that a toothbrush can't get to.

Developing an Oral Routine for Your Kid



It is essential to establish a constant oral regimen for your kid, ensuring that they brush and floss their teeth consistently. By establishing great dental hygiene practices at a young age, you're establishing your kid up for a life time of healthy and balanced teeth and gums.

Here are 3 key actions to assist you develop an oral routine for your kid:

2. Introduce brushing: As soon as your youngster's very first tooth shows up, begin utilizing a little, soft-bristled toothbrush and a rice-sized quantity of fluoride toothpaste. Brush their teeth two times a day, ensuring to get to all surface areas.

3. Motivate flossing: When your kid's teeth begin touching, generally around the age of 2 or three, introduce flossing. Use child-friendly flossers or floss choices to make it easier for them.

Tips for Stopping Dental Caries in Child Pearly Whites



To prevent dental cavity in your kid's primary teeth, adhere to these simple suggestions.

- First, make certain to cleanse your kid's teeth two times a day making use of a soft-bristled tooth brush and a pea-sized amount of fluoride toothpaste. Urge them to spit out the toothpaste instead of swallowing it.

- Limit sweet drinks and snacks, as they can contribute to tooth decay. Instead, offer healthy and balanced snacks like fruits and vegetables.

- Avoid placing your child to bed with a bottle or sippy cup full of sweet fluids, as this can lead to dental caries.

- Finally, schedule normal dental check-ups for your kid, beginning with the age of one year.
